Location: Onsite Jacksonville Schedule: Monday-Friday 9am-6pm Salary: $17.72 - $22.15 per hour based on experience What work will you perform? As an Hours-of-Service Compliance Coordinator, you will play a vital role in ensuring our CDL Owner Operators or Business Capacity Owners (BCOs) operate safely and within federal, state, and company regulations. Your primary responsibility will be to promote and enforce Hours-of-Service (HOS) compliance through regular audits, training, and driver education. Your experience with customer service, auditing, and proactive guidance will allow you to thrive in this role. This is an excellent opportunity to build expertise in transportation compliance, strengthen your customer service and analytical skills, and be part of a team that directly impacts the safety and efficiency of Landstar's logistics network.
